Application of Strong Vibration Acidizing Technology in Henan Oil Field

Abstract

Strong vibration acidizing technology was applied in Henan oilfield because of the heterogeneity, low permeability and serious popullation near wellbore zone of the reservoir in the oilfield. The technology combines physical plug removal with chemical acidizing, and it has better effectiveness and longer valid period than conventional acidizing technology. The technology was applied in 36 wells (29 water injection wells, 7 oil wells), success percentage reaches to 100%, effectiveness percentage reaches to 90.62%, the increase of water injection rate accumulates 44万m3, and average valid period reaches to above 8 monthes. The results of the field tests show that the technology has a good and soon result of plug removal for water injection wells and oil wells, and it is espectically suited to the treatment of the oil sandbody updip pinch out reservoirs which have bad physical property.
